I visit the States a fair bit and find most PC stuff is about the same price or even more expensive than here. Add in the cost of carriage, Customs Duty, and Vat and it often just isn't worth it. And if you've got to return it when it goes belly up? Too much hassle. Stick to CDs and DVDs.
